Convert the equation into y = mx + b form:

2x + 3y = 6

-2x -2x

3y = 6 - 2x

Divide both sides by 3:

y = 2- 2/3x

If we move the terms around to put in in y = mx + b:

y = -2/3x + 2

m is the slope, so the slope is -2/3
